Shaq Delos Santos will work with what he has with PWNVT in PSL


After Tiebreaker Times broke the news that Creamline Cool Smashers Alyssa Valdez and Jia Morado are not participating in the Chooks to Go-Philippine Superliga Invitational Cup with the Philippine Women’s National Volleyball Team, head coach Shaq Delos Santos remains focused on getting the nationals prepared.

Speaking with the media during the Invitational Cup press event Thursday afternoon, Delos Santos emphasized his full understanding of Valdez and Morado’s situation.

Having been the coach of Petron last year when the national team campaigned in numerous tournaments overseas, Delos Santos sees how the conflict with club commitments and national team duties can greatly affect players.

“I think ‘di naman totally magiging problem for us kasi napaka-flexible and very understanding ng players.

“Pero definitely sa practice, pumupunta naman sila. Isa din sa sobrang importante yung practice namin,” Delos Santos said of Valdez and Morado.

“Kung di sila makalaro, kung sino yung nanduyan, tatrabahuhin namin. Pero pagdating ng training namin, definitely kasama sila,” he added.

“So open kami sa lahat. Yun nga, lagi naming sinasabi na kung saan tayo magme-meet para lang ma-solve natin yung mga problems na darating, gawin natin.”

The national team will play against 6 PSL clubs as a guest team throughout the Invitational Cup. If a player takes on her club team, she plays for the club team.

Even Delos Santos will coach Petron when they play the nationals.
